The Sales

FOR BASICS
Write it down so you remember in ten months: Stuart Weitzman’s December sale has incremental markdowns. The first pair is marked down 30 percent, the second 40, and the third 50. The atmosphere is claustrophobic but civilized. 625 Madison Ave., nr. 59th St.; 212-750-2555.

FOR FLATS
The Delman sales, which take place in the company’s showroom in May and November, are total chaos as women rummage through box after box, but the extensive stock means there’s a good chance of finding a foot-slimming flat in your size for about $100 (versus $314.95 in the store). The showroom is moving in March. Call 212-399-2323 for new location details.

FOR NEW STYLES
A schlep to Flatbush, and the store’s odd hours (it closes at 5:30), means that Shoes at Esti’s is still under the radar for designer shoes at a bargain. The June and December sales are worth it; recently, a pair of Marc by Marc Jacobs black suede peep toes trimmed with black and white lizard were whittled down to $158. 1888 Coney Island Ave., nr. Ave. O, Flatbush, Brooklyn; 718-376-3661.

FOR PARTY SHOES
There are two Chuckies locations, so stampedes are unlikely during the biannual sales. Good for Dolce & Gabbana, Miu Miu, Alessandro Dell’Acqua, etc. 1073 Third Ave., nr. 63rd St.; 212-593-9898; and 1169 Madison Ave., at 86th St.; 212-249-2254.
